What a billing invoice template for finance is and why it matters

A billing invoice template for finance is a standardized document used to record and present charges for goods or services, capturing payer details, line items, taxes, totals, payment terms, and remittance instructions. In finance teams this template enforces consistent account coding, supports accounts receivable workflows, and simplifies reconciliation with the general ledger. A well-designed template reduces disputes by clearly showing due dates and accepted payment methods, and it serves as the primary source for automated reminders, audit trails, and archival retention required for financial reporting and compliance.

Common challenges when using billing invoice templates

  • Inconsistent fields across departments create mismatched GL codes and slow month-end close processes.
  • Manual edits to invoices increase the risk of calculation mistakes and missing tax details.
  • Lack of template version control leads to outdated payment terms and compliance gaps.
  • Poorly formatted invoices cause delays in payer processing and increased days sales outstanding.

Step-by-step: Creating a billing invoice template for finance

Follow these four steps to design and deploy a consistent billing invoice template that supports accounting controls and payment processing.

  • 01
    Define fields: List required fields such as invoice number, dates, line items, taxes, GL codes.
  • 02
    Format layout: Arrange header, line-item table, and totals for clear scanning and automated parsing.
  • 03
    Set rules: Establish mandatory fields, validation rules, and allowed tax treatments for accuracy.
  • 04
    Deploy template: Publish template to billing systems, train users, and version-control updates.

Best practices for secure, accurate billing invoice templates

Follow these principles to keep templates consistent, auditable, and compliant while optimizing for collections and reconciliation.

Standardize required fields and enforce validation rules
Define mandatory fields like invoice number, issue date, due date, line-item descriptions, unit prices, tax treatment, and GL code mapping. Enforce validation to prevent incomplete invoices and to support automated ingestion into accounting systems.
Version control and change management for templates
Track template versions and maintain a documented approval process for updates. Keep an archive of prior versions for audit purposes and clearly date-stamp templates to prevent accidental use of outdated formats.
Implement secure distribution and access restrictions
Use secure links with expirations, password protection, and role-based access to limit who can view or download invoices. Configure audit logging to record access and downloads for compliance and dispute resolution.
Automate reconciliation and attach supporting documents
Include invoice metadata that maps to purchase orders and receipts. Attach or link supporting documents like signed contracts to streamline three-way matching and accelerate payment processing.

Document retention and backup guidance for finance invoices

Retention policies and backup schedules help satisfy regulatory obligations and internal audit requirements for financial records.

Standard retention for financial records:

Seven years recommended retention

Tax-related invoice retention:

Keep tax-related invoices for at least seven years

Short-term backup cadence:

Daily incremental backups

Long-term archive schedule:

Annual archival exports

Legal hold procedures:

Suspend deletions when litigation arises
